Generally
A recipient is a person who receives something (item, goods, services, money) from someone or some entity (such as an individual, group, organization, company, or agency).
Social Welfare Programs
A recipient is a person who receives some type of public "assistance" through a State or Federal program in the USA. The most obvious is public welfare programs that offer cash, food stamps, or medical payments,
Medical
A recipient is the specific person who is receiving the blood, organ donation, etc.
